Saturday Is Prescription Drug Take Back Day

News

April 19th, 2023 by Ric Hanson

(Radio Iowa) – National Prescription Drug Take Back Day is this Saturday from 10 a-m until 2 p-m. The D-E-A’s Emily Murray says the majority of people who have misused prescription medications in the past got them from family members or friends or they stole them from a family member or friend. Murray says. two-thirds of teens who have misused pain relievers in the past got those prescription medications from family and friends.

You can find a site to take back your prescription drugs at TakeBackDay.com.

As of April 19, 2023, here are Drug Take Back collection site sponsors and locations in the KJAN listening area:

  • In Atlantic: the Drop-off box is permanently located in the entryway to the Atlantic Police Dept., during business hours
  • Red Oak Police Dept.: Drop-off site at the Red Oak Hy-Vee.
  • Council Bluffs Police Dept.: Drop-off site at the Walgreens Store.
  • Dallas County Sheriff’s Office: Drop-off site at the Sheriff’s Office in Adel.
  • Ringgold County Sheriff’s Office: Drop-off site at the Sheriff’s Office in Mount Ayr.

The take back event lets you turn in the medication anonymously. “Some people are fine just tossing their prescription pill bottles into the box or the receptacle. Other people feel a little bit more comfortable putting their prescription medications inside a brown bag and dropping that off,” She says. “This is definitely no questions asked. It’s a very safe and anonymous way to drop off your medications.”

She says they will also take back vaping devices and cartridges. “But the only thing that we asked with that is that you please remove the lithium battery and we may ask you just to show that the battery has been removed before we before you drop that into the receptacle,” Murray says. She says they will not take back sharp items like syringes, or illegal drugs.

Bridal Company To Lay Off Employees At 4 Iowa Stores

News

April 19th, 2023 by Ric Hanson

(Radio Iowa) – David’s Bridal has fil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ection for the second time in five years — which will lead to the lay off of 94 employees at four Iowa stores. The company has notified Iowa Workforce Development that it plans to lay off 29 employees in Clive, 22 in Davenport, 26 in Marion and 17 in Sioux City. The layoffs in Iowa will begin June 12th.

Olympic champion 110 meter hurdler to open season at Drake Relays

Sports

April 19th, 2023 by Ric Hanson

Olympic champion Hansle Parchment will open his season next week in the 110 meter hurdles at the Drake Relays. Parchment won gold for Jamaica in 2021 in Tokyo and has been a regular at Drake.

Parchment battled injury for much of 2022 and hopes Drake will provide a good start to the new season.

Parchment spent the offseason working with his coach on the technical aspects of his race.

Parchment says he needs better starts to return to contention at the world level.

The Drake Relays are April 25th through the 29th.

Search continues for missing Muscatine man in Iowa City

News

April 19th, 2023 by Ric Hanson

(Radio Iowa) – Iowa City Police are asking for the public’s help with information in the search for a missing man from Muscatine. Police say 20-year-old Cristian Martinez was last seen walking on the street just before 1 a-m Saturday.

There’s been no activity on his bank account or cellphone. Police say they followed up on numerous tips, and searches of several sources of surveillance video have failed to give them any leads. Police say drones and boats have been used to search along the Iowa River as that’s the direction he was heading in when last seen. The Army Corps of Engineers cut the outflow of the Coralville Reservoir to aid in the search.
